Basketball Recap: Upper Scioto Valley Rams vs. Elgin Comets

The Upper Scioto Valley Rams's recent rough patch got a bit rougher on Thursday after their fourth straight loss. They were dealt a 52-25 loss at the hands of Elgin. Upper Scioto Valley has struggled against the Comets recently, as their match on Thursday was their eighth consecutive lost matchup.

Defeat or not, Upper Scioto Valley got some senior leadership from Patiance Cole and Nevaeh Lowery. Cole scored four points along with 11 rebounds and two steals, while Lowery. scored ten points along with two steals. Cole has been hot recently, having posted eight or more rebounds the last three times she's played.

Multiple players turned in solid performances to lead Elgin to victory, but perhaps none more so than Maycee Muselin, who scored 18 points along with five rebounds and two steals. Another player making a difference was Samantha Girton, who scored 11 points along with eight rebounds and eight steals.

Upper Scioto Valley has not been sharp recently as the team's lost nine of their last 11 contests, which put a noticeable dent in their 5-14 record this season. As for Elgin, their victory bumped their record up to 12-6.

Both teams are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Upper Scioto Valley will take on the Redskins at 12:00 p.m. on Saturday. Arcadia presents a significant challenge as they come into the match much higher ranked than the Rams in Ohio (the Redskins are ranked 235th, while the Rams are ranked 711th). As for Elgin, they will be playing at home against the Commodores at 6:00 p.m. on Thursday. Perry is coming into the match hot, having won their last five games.
